Output 7e863778f36fad49dc53b7b1c4e817c890df56610ed6a8a2d05d897b33f9cc45:0

value
17653792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9acfc4a996697c749604e604e951cafb3651b9e8 OP_EQUAL
address
3Foat5FedLDix8JJbPtUtzHPey59p9y2HR
transaction
7e863778f36fad49dc53b7b1c4e817c890df56610ed6a8a2d05d897b33f9cc45